4 Star 11 Fork 8

鸣飞/BuildH框架代码开发辅助工具

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
文件
克隆/下载
Enums.cs 2.83 KB
一键复制 编辑 原始数据 按行查看 历史
鸣飞 提交于 6年前 . xxx
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Linq;
using System.Text;
namespace CodeGenerator.Core
{
/// <summary>
/// 数据库类型枚举值
/// </summary>
public enum DatabaseType
{
SqlServer,
PostgreSQL,
MySql,
Sqlite,
Oracle
}
public enum ControlType
{
[Description("单行文本")]
Text,
[Description("多行文本")]
TextArea,
[Description("日期类型")]
DateTime,
[Description("数值类型")]
Numeric,
[Description("下拉列表")]
Select,
[Description("复选框")]
CheckBox
}
/// <summary>
/// 生成代码类型
/// </summary>
public enum CodeType
{
NET,
Java
}
/// <summary>
/// 树节点类型
/// </summary>
public enum TreeNodeType
{
Server,
DataBase,
TableNode,
ViewNode,
Table,
View,
Field
}
/// <summary>
/// 文件类型
/// </summary>
public enum FileType
{
cs,
java,
sql,
txt,
html,
cshtml,
jsp,
empty
}
public enum FileOperateType
{
/// <summary>
/// 添加文件夹
/// </summary>
AddDirection,
/// <summary>
/// 添加文件
/// </summary>
AddFile,
/// <summary>
/// 文件重命名
/// </summary>
Rename
}
/// <summary>
/// 数据字典生成类型
/// </summary>
public enum BuilderDictType
{
Excel,
Html,
Word,
Chm
}
/// <summary>
/// 程序生成方式
/// </summary>
public enum BuilderType
{
/// <summary>
/// 常规模式
/// </summary>
Default,
/// <summary>
/// 工厂模式
/// </summary>
Factory
}
/// <summary>
/// 生成方法
/// </summary>
public enum BuilderMethods
{
/// <summary>
/// 增加
/// </summary>
Add,
/// <summary>
/// 修改
/// </summary>
Update,
/// <summary>
/// 删除
/// </summary>
Delete,
/// <summary>
/// 查询所有记录
/// </summary>
SelectAll,
/// <summary>
/// 查询主键记录
/// </summary>
SelectByKey,
/// <summary>
/// 判断记录是否存在
/// </summary>
Exists,
/// <summary>
/// 查询记录总数
/// </summary>
Count
}
}
Loading...
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化
C#
1
https://gitee.com/mf_/CodeGenerator.git
git@gitee.com:mf_/CodeGenerator.git
mf_
CodeGenerator
BuildH框架代码开发辅助工具
master

搜索帮助